Computer Apple MacMini M4 Silver M4-10C-CPU 16GB 1TB SSD 1GB Ethernet OS
The Apple MacMini M4 Silver (M4-10C CPU, 10C GPU) is a compact desktop computer designed for general computing, creative workflows and office environments. Equipped with 16GB of unified memory and a 1TB solid-state drive, the Mac mini provides responsive multitasking and fast file access. The device runs macOS and includes a 1Gb Ethernet port for stable wired network connections. Its small footprint makes it suitable for limited workspaces while delivering the processing power required for everyday applications and more demanding tasks.
The MacMini M4 combines a high-efficiency M4 processor and integrated 10-core GPU to offer consistent performance for application switching, multimedia playback and basic content creation. The 16GB memory configuration supports smooth multitasking across productivity apps and browser tabs, while the 1TB SSD ensures quick boot times and rapid access to large files. A 1Gb Ethernet connection provides reliable wired networking for data transfer and low-latency access to network resources. The compact silver chassis allows simple placement on a desk or in a shared workspace without occupying much space.
Connect the Mac mini to a display, keyboard and mouse using available ports, or integrate it into an existing workspace through standard peripherals. After powering on, follow the macOS setup assistant to configure user accounts, network settings and iCloud if required. Install necessary applications from the App Store or direct downloads, and use Time Machine or other backup solutions to protect important data. For networked environments, connect the Ethernet cable to the 1Gb port for a stable wired connection and configure network preferences in system settings.
Place the MacMini on a flat, ventilated surface and allow space around the chassis for airflow. Keep macOS updated to ensure security and performance improvements. For heavier multimedia projects, consider external storage or cloud services to extend available capacity and offload large media files.
